Aims

The project objective is to validate and extend previous agronomic and management research on how to successfully establish canola in the low rainfall zones of WA, as well as including feedback on what has/has not worked for growers through a series of field trial demonstrations and extension. By the conclusion of the project in March 2024, 60% of canola growers in the low rainfall zones of the Western Region will have access to the agronomic knowledge to improve the establishment and germination rates of canola.
Specifically, the project aims to:
1) Provide trial data and visual evidence of treatments that maximize canola establishment
2) Evaluate the ease of implementation of the treatments
3) Discuss and assess possible limitations to grower operation.

Key messages

1. The placement of the seed relative to soil moisture and soil temperature conditions at sowing during 2022 and 2023 seasons had the largest influence on canola establishment across the low rainfall zones of WA. Delaying sowing to avoid exposing the canola seed and seedlings to high temperatures and placing the seed shallow in the soil profile above soil moisture in North Mallee (2023), Merredin (2022), Morawa (2022 and 2022), and Yuna (2023) maximised canola establishment, with a follow up rainfall event.
2. Grading open pollinated seed to above 1.8 mm was shown to improve canola establishment on a sandy soil type in North Mallee (2023), however, did not influence canola establishment in Merredin (2022) or Holt Rock (2023) on heavier soil types where soil moisture was present at seeding.
3. Fertilizer placement was shown to influence canola establishment at Cunderdin with the increased separation UAN below the seed associated with improved establishment.
4. The use of 25 cm row spacing (compared to 75 cm spacing) maximised canola establishment rates at Southern Cross.
5. The addition of SACOA SE14 soil wetter did not significantly influence canola establishment in any of the nine trials in which it was tested. However, good soil moisture was present at sowing for majority of the trials and subsequently the influence of soil wetters on canola establishment requires further research in varying seasons.
6. Besides the two trials at Yuna in 2023, none of the trials experienced a dry season start for seeding. Further canola establishment research is required to better understand how to avoid large canola establishment failures in unfavourably dry sowing conditions.
